Abstract

The invention discloses an expressway front vehicle detection method. The method includes the following steps that: multi-scale transformation is performed on acquired original images of expressway front vehicles, so that contracted images can be obtained; edge detection is performed on the contracted images, so that detection result images of vehicle contours can be obtained; the detection result images of the vehicle contours are numbered, so that numbered vehicles can be obtained; the numbered images are scanned, and the external rectangle of each numbered vehicle is calculated, and the parameters of the external rectangle of each numbered vehicle can be calculated according to the obtained external rectangle. The expressway front vehicle detection method has the advantages of stable calculation results as well as being concise and effective, and can effectively reflect the driving conditions of the front vehicles through the parameters of the external rectangles.

Description

Technical field: [0001] The invention relates to a method for detecting road vehicles, in particular to a method for detecting vehicles in front of an expressway. Background technique: [0002] By the end of 2013, the national highway mileage reached 104,400 kilometers, ranking first in the world. China's expressway construction is now in a period of rapid development. However, compared with other grades of roads, or compared with other countries' expressways, the safety situation of my country's expressways is not optimistic, and the accident rate and accident severity are relatively high. . It is foreseeable that the safety situation of expressways will become more and more serious with the development of economy and society, as well as the increase of car ownership and expressway mileage.
